Cant browse below root of mount point in cluster when trying to restore database

$
0
0

Howdy

Running SQL 2008 R2 SP1 cluster on Windows 2008 R2 server.

I have 8 instances of SQL running.

Trying to browse below a mount point to select a file to restore a database, but I cant browse the directory structure below the root of most of the mount points, but I can browse the dir tree under the RecycleBin, MSDTC, System Volume Information mount points.

I have checked the security on all the other mount points for all the other instances, and its identical. On the other 7 instances I can browse dir treet & restore fine.

I do have a work aorund if I put in the full path to the directory and the file name and it will find it and restore fine.

All the clutser resources & dependencies are fine. SQL runs fine, the disks fail over & back fine.

I have checked the privs for the account running SQL and its the same as we use for the other instances.

Thoughts welcome - its got me baffled.
